Search the Mod Portal by entering a search term.
To search for specific phrases, surround them with double quotes (").
The mod portal will match your query against the mod title, internal name, summary, and username of the mod owner.
To further refine your search, use the sidebar on the left. Enable the checkboxes to limit the search results to selected categories and tags or use the ban button to exclude them.
You can reset your filters by clicking the active tab on the top.
There's a lot of caching on this page. It can take several hours for new mods and updates to show up in search results.
